Film Night in the NOHO Arts District March 30, 2007
Film Night is a monthly presentation of films presented by IDEAS
(Investigative Documentaries Educating American Society) in association with the International
Student Film Festival Hollywood (ISFFH). IDEAS mission is to educate American society on
the most important social subjects facing America going into the 21st century. ISFFH offers student filmmakers from all over the world a unique opportunity
to gain the recognition of film industry leaders, create career development opportunities in their home countries and the
U.S., and celebrate new artistic discoveries from all over the world. Film Night offers an insight to the work of fellow filmmakers
with personal interaction, including a question and answer period after each film.

The Institute for Spiritual Entertainment Los Angeles (ISELA) is an up and coming community in Los Angeles. Their purpose
is to promote the new genre of films called Spiritual Cinema/Transformational Media. ISELA's mission is to create and
produce movies as well as other media that awaken the truth within us in order to inspire individual and social transformation.
The idea is to ask such questions as "who are we?" and "why are we here?" provoking change toward higher
consciousness and awareness. Our intent is to assist others in making films from their highest place while expressing their
true selves.
ISELA's first production is called The Gentle Barn. It is an inspiring
short based on a true story about an Alzheimer's patient named Thomas and how he is transformed when a Spiritual connection
is made between him and the farm animals of The Gentle Barn. It is a shining example of how a professional production can
be done in harmony with Spiritual values.
